Domaine La Curnière's 2023 Vacqueyras Rouge is a compelling expression of the southern Rhône, capturing the essence of its terroir in a vibrant and youthful vintage. While the precise blend is not specified, Vacqueyras reds are typically dominated by Grenache, often complemented by Syrah and Mourvèdre, resulting in wines with both ripe fruit character and structural depth. In the glass, expect a deep ruby colour with aromas of blackberries, ripe plums, garrigue herbs and subtle spice notes—testament to both the grape varieties and the warm, sun-drenched conditions of the vintage. The palate should reveal generous fruit, a touch of liquorice and pepper, all underpinned by robust yet approachable tannins that promise both immediate pleasure and moderate cellaring potential. Traditional vinification in this region preserves fruit vibrancy while allowing the wine’s complex aromatics to shine through.
Vacqueyras is nestled in the heart of the southern Rhône Valley, lying just east of Châteauneuf-du-Pape along the slopes of the Dentelles de Montmirail. The region benefits from a Mediterranean climate, marked by hot, dry summers and cooling Mistral winds that encourage healthy, concentrated grapes. The soils are diverse, combining clay, sand, limestone and stony alluvium, which provide both drainage and mineral complexity—factors that contribute to the power and balance that define the region’s reds. The area’s winemaking history extends back to Roman times and Vacqueyras was elevated to appellation status in 1990, reflecting both its heritage and quality.
For food pairings, this Vacqueyras shines alongside hearty, rustic cuisine. Think Provençal daube (beef stew with olives and herbs), lamb shoulder roasted with thyme and rosemary, or even grilled duck breast with a fig reduction. Regional dishes such as ratatouille or aubergine gratin also complement the wine’s herbaceous and savoury undertones. Hard cheeses like aged Comté or a mature Cantal make fine accompaniments as well.
For the best experience, serve this wine at 16-18°C to allow its bouquet and layered flavours to unfold. If consumed in its youth, decanting for an hour can help soften the tannins and enhance aromatic complexity.
